TATA Technologies
Location
Bangalore | India
Job description
Key Responsibilities:
Review and analyze interface requirements from application and base SW teams, cross check and validate interface to match, identify dependencies, lead interface requirements conflict resolution
Create and validate interface files and ARXMLs within sandbox space before submission
Update SW component skeleton model with newly created and modified interfaces
Deliver updated and verified interface, ARXML, composition, skeleton and code (C, header and data dictionary) files in GIT HUB for successful RTE generation
Support RTE generation process by promptly resolve errors incurred during RTE generation
Create new SW components, new or updated data definition, new interfaces and runnables, update models with variant configurations, new enumerations definitions, new memory definitions, as needed
Maintain documentation of work packages deliveries on GIT HUB
Run scripts to update all models, ARXMLs, interfaces, compositions, code and data dictionary after RTE completion, for integration of SW
Generate testing harness and perform MIL/SIL with model and code
Make model updates in agreement with the primary controls engineer
Run custom scripts and tool to assure model is compliant to current Stellantis autocoding modelling practices.
Support SW engineer for model and code review to assure best autocoding practices
Identify opportunities for process improvements for RTE generation
Qualifications & Skills Required:
Required Bachelors (Preferred Masters) degree in Electrical Engineering, Controls Engineering, or Information Technology
Proven experience with automotive embedded SW development, including AUTOSAR
Experience with System Desk, Matlab Simulink, GIT HUB, ETAS Isolar
Detail-oriented with strong organizational and multitasking abilities
Job tags
Salary